The UN has commented on the decision to close the United States Agency for International Development (USAID).

Axar.az reports that Deputy Spokesperson for the UN Secretary-General Farhan Haq noted that the organization he represents is committed to a constructive dialogue with the US leadership.

The spokesperson said that the UN is aware of the US government's decision to suspend foreign aid funding: "We comply with all legal instructions in our member states. USAID has a long history of cooperation with various governments of the organization's member states."

It should be noted that the official USAID website is currently inactive. The Trump administration is considering the possibility of revoking USAID's independent status and integrating it into the structure of the State Department. US Secretary of State Marco Rubio has been appointed acting director of USAID.
